I found this interesting.  What would I shoot if I were watching this scene.  Mainly I think I am interested in the artist and the model and his work.  So I would move to left, widen the perspective on both bodies, and shoot from more behind him and keep the mother out of the frame.  Maybe not possible, but it is my reaction that she is not essential to the story here.  Your mileage may vary as they say in Detroit:-)  The side lighting on the young miss is attractive and I like that part.... aloha, gs

I like the composition. My eye moves around from the artist to the drawing to the mother and the river. The young woman's apparent awareness of the photographer, of having her picture made twice is at first distracting. Then I thought that her awareness of having her picture made twice is in some ways the subject of the picture. To be beautiful and gazed at. Perhaps that is what the mother worries about.
